Where to RV in Ohio?

My job is moving me from California to Central Ohio. I've always RVd in/near the mountains or the coast, so I'm hoping someone can convince me to keep my 5th wheel after I move there. Do folks enjoy their RVs in those parts or do they sink into deep RV withdrawal syndrome? I would love to hear perspectives. Thanks.
  • While Ohio can be a bit cold and has a bit of a reduced RV season. There are lots of lake areas,woods,and fun places to camp. bring you RV there is no shortage of good RV destinations in Ohio
  • My family is from Ohio for generations and I have lived Florida since 69.

    Bring your RV. Not only is Ohio rich in places to see, Amish Country for one, but Michigan is beautiful. Youghiogheny (yockahaney) in Pa is close. So much close by plus your within striking distance to Maine and New England. Not to mention a two day drive to Florida, one day to the Carolina's.
